Christmas Day is supposed to be a peaceful time to spend with your friends and family but for two diehard NBA fans, a Twitter spat over Kobe Bryant led to Xmas Day fireworks and entertainment for those who may have been a little tired of spending time with their families. During the Lakers-Bulls matchup, Twitter users @SnottieDrippen & @MyTweetsRealAF got in a heated argument over Kobe and his impact on the Lakers this year. For a little taste of the back-and-forth, peep these tweets:


The conversation carried on like that for a while until @MyTweetsRealAF decided enough was enough and told his adversary that he was going to fight him outside the Gold's Gym in Temecula, California.


Of course, things like this happen everyday on social media but @MyTweetsRealAF made the 35-minute drive (on Christmas Day, no less) to settle this in the streets. @SnottieDrippen was spending Xmas in Arizona and was a no-show but Twitter went nuts and "Temecula" became a trending topic.

@MyTweetsRealAF wasn't done there. The beef has now gone on wax as the Twitter user dropped a diss track over Drake's "0-To-100." The escalating beef got so big that even Kobe has chimed in telling ESPN's Arash Markazi, "Mamba army don't fuck around. They take after their captain."
